#1: Know why clear braces are great

It's important for you to look into clear braces as an option because they're great at fixing your smile and making sure that you're able to chew comfortably. If you have teeth that are misaligned, you might hurt your jaw and will be uncomfortable as you eat. Having gaps in your mouth with also leave you more open to infections and you'll breed bacteria in your mouth. This will lead to gum disease and cavities if you're not fixing your teeth and allowing the gaps to get worse. You'll want to contact the best dental professional to help you out. 

#2: Shop for your clear braces

To be sure that you're able to get braces, speak to as many orthodontists as possible. If you touch base with some orthodontists in your area, you'll find that you're better able to find the best brand of invisible braces for you. Invisalign is a popular option, and you'll want to speak to dental professionals that can help you understand what to expect. Invisible braces will cost you between about $3,500 and $8,000, so it is also important for you to speak to your dental insurance provider and dentist to make sure you're able to pay for it. 

#3: Take care of your invisible braces

It's important that you purchase a few items that will keep your invisible braces clean and well-maintained. There are some toothbrushes that are specially crafted to care for your teeth in a way that doesn't damage your clear braces. You will also want to look into various soaking solutions so that you're able to keep your braces clean since you're going to be wearing them for several hours each day.
